At 11 a.m. on Friday, Feb. 12, Agri-Pulse will host a bipartisan virtual discussion about the major rural issues before Congress, including the pandemic, unemployment, broadband, farming, and the environmental impact of natural disasters and wildfires.
The free webinar, which will last about an hour, will feature House Agriculture members Abigail Spanberger, D-Va., and Dusty Johnson, R-S.D., along with manufacturing lobbyist Kip Eidberg (his employer, the Association of Equipment Manufacturers, is sponsoring the webinar). Agri-Pulse managing editor Spencer Chase will moderate.
Within the Agriculture committee, both representatives serve on the Commodity Exchanges, Energy, and Credit subcommittee. Johnson also serves on the Nutrition, Oversight, and Department Operations subcommittee, and Spanberger chairs the Conservation and Forestry subcommittee.
